Galvanized Steel Coil

Galvanized Steel Coil is a carbon steel sheet coated with zinc on both sides by a continuous hot-dip process. This zinc coating protects the base metal from corrosion and extends the product’s service life. Type of Galvanized Steel Coil

  • Hot-Dip Galvanized (GI): Steel is immersed in a molten zinc bath, resulting in a thicker, more lasting coating with better corrosion resistance.
  • Electro-Galvanized (EG): A thinner zinc layer is applied via electrolysis, offering a smoother finish suitable for aesthetic applications but with less corrosion resistance compared to hot-dip.
  • Galvannealed (GA): Heat treatment of hot-dip galvanized steel to generate a zinc-iron alloy coating that improves weldability and paintability.
  • Other Variants: Zinc-aluminum-magnesium coatings (e.g., PosMAC) or Galvalume (zinc-aluminum alloy) for enhanced performance in specific environments.
